A Tale Break up Involving Gentle and Shadow
At the center of Echoes is its dual-entire world framework, a structure preference that reshapes how gamers investigate the planet Aether. When Samus Aran is shipped to investigate a lost Federation squad, she quickly discovers that Aether has been split into two Proportions: Gentle Aether and Dark Aether. The latter is a twisted, hostile reflection of the former, teeming with toxic environments and lethal enemies. Navigating in between these worlds isn’t simply a gimmick — it’s the Main on the knowledge.
This mechanic provides a continuing feeling of tension. In Darkish Aether, health consistently drains Except Samus is inside of protecting light bubbles, forcing players to prepare routes and have interaction in fights with time stress. It's a survival factor exceptional in Metroid game titles, one which provides urgency towards the exploration-large gameplay.
Gameplay Evolution and Precision
When Echoes retains the first-individual adventure format of its predecessor, it provides levels of complexity. New beam weapons — Gentle, Darkish, and later Annihilator — are central to development, each with distinctive ammo and properties. Doors, enemies, and puzzles are tied to those weapons, necessitating strategic use in lieu of brute power.
Fight is more durable and more tactical than in the main Primary. Enemies tend to be more aggressive, save stations are less Repeated, and manager fights are extended and even more intricate. The inclusion from the Ing, sinister creatures from Darkish Aether, provides towards the regular sense of dread. The reappearance of Darkish Samus, a corrupted doppelgänger of Samus born from Phazon, introduces a unforgettable and recurring antagonist.
World-Constructing and Visible Style
Aether by itself is wonderfully crafted. Each and every zone, within the luminous Temple Grounds towards the eerie Torvus Bog, is distinct and immersive. Retro Studios excelled at creating a believable planet, working with environmental storytelling and refined visual cues to guide the player By natural means throughout the video game's interconnected areas.
The game’s signature scanning mechanic returns, encouraging gamers to uncover the loaded record of Aether and its indigenous Luminoth civilization. The narrative unfolds slowly and gradually, revealing a war amongst mild and dim that mirrors Samus’s individual journey.
